Solution for 19-u=3 equation:


Simplifying
19 + -1u = 3

Solving
19 + -1u = 3

Solving for variable 'u'.

Move all terms containing u to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-19' to each side of the equation.
19 + -19 + -1u = 3 + -19

Combine like terms: 19 + -19 = 0
0 + -1u = 3 + -19
-1u = 3 + -19

Combine like terms: 3 + -19 = -16
-1u = -16

Divide each side by '-1'.
u = 16

Simplifying
u = 16
